Directions for use: For harmonious burning, do not extinguish the candle until its "pool" has formed, in other words when the entire surface has become liquid
For clean burning: adjust the length of the wick by cutting it before each use. It must be approximately .25"
To preserve the candle: when not in use, do not expose it to temperatures that are too high.
